通过命令行连接Oracle数据库(cmd oracle链接)

通过命令行连接Oracle数据库

当需要连接一个Oracle数据库时,我们通常会使用图形化的Oracle客户端,如SQL Developer等。但是有时候,我们需要在服务器上运行一些脚本或程序,并且不能使用图形化界面,这时候,通过命令行连接Oracle数据库成为了必须掌握的技能。

在Linux和Unix系统中,我们可以使用sqlplus命令连接Oracle数据库。以下是连接Oracle数据库的步骤。

步骤1:打开终端并输入以下命令以打开sqlplus:

sqlplus

步骤2:输入以下命令以连接数据库:

connect /@:/

其中,是你的数据库用户名,是你的数据库密码,是你的数据库服务器的主机名或IP地址,是你的数据库服务器的端口号(通常为1521),是你的数据库实例的SID(System Identifier)。

例如:

connect hr/hr@localhost:1521/orcl

在上述示例中,我们使用用户名和密码“hr”连接到本地主机的Oracle数据库实例“orcl”。

步骤3:一旦成功连接,sqlplus提示符会更改为“SQL>”,这表明你已经成功连接到数据库。此时,你可以开始输入SQL命令来查询或修改数据了。

例如:

SQL> select * from employees;

此命令将显示所有员工的数据。

步骤4:若要断开与数据库的连接,请输入以下命令:

disconnect
exit

以上命令将从数据库断开连接并退出sqlplus。

总结

通过命令行连接Oracle数据库是一项非常有用的技能,在一些场景中非常有用,如在服务器上运行程序或脚本时。以上是连接Oracle数据库的基本步骤,以及一些常见的sqlplus命令。需要注意的是,操作系统和Oracle数据库版本不同,实际操作可能会有所不同。在实际使用中,我们还可以使用一些第三方工具来简化连接操作,如AutoSqlplus。


数据运维技术 » 通过命令行连接Oracle数据库(cmd oracle链接)